Solana Price Falters Below Resistance, Targets $60 and $50

Solana's price is facing a critical technical test as it struggles below resistance, with traders watching $60 support as the next downside target. The cryptocurrency has been trading near $73 after recovering slightly from recent weakness, but the latest technical setup remains under pressure as traders monitor whether Solana can defend key support levels or extend the correction further.

According to Brave New Coin data, Solana is currently trading around $73.16 with a market capitalization of approximately $42.5 billion. The short-term structure has weakened after breaking below a multi-month symmetrical triangle pattern, raising concerns about a deeper correction.

Coin Signals highlighted the breakdown from the pattern, with the chart projecting a downside move towards the $60-$50 region if sellers maintain control. For bulls, reclaiming the $75-$80 area would be important, as it could weaken the bearish breakdown setup and open the possibility of a recovery towards $90-$100.
